White Collar is concerning the unlikely partnership of any con artist and an FBI agent who’ve been playing cat and mouse for decades.
Neal Caffrey, an incredibly charming criminal mastermind, is finally caught simply by his nemesis, G-Man extraordinaire Peter Stokes. When Neal escapes coming from a maximum-security prison to find his long-lost love, Peter nabs him yet again. Rather than returning to be able to jail for his bold getaway, Neal suggests an switch plan: he’ll provide his cunning criminal expertise to support the Feds in catching other notorious and challenging criminals. Initially wary, Peter quickly finds that Neal provides insight along with intuition that cannot be located on the right side of legislation.
White Collar is the USA Network television series manufactured by Jeff Eastin, starring Matt Bomer while con-man Neal Caffrey in addition to Tim DeKay as Exclusive Agent Peter Burke. It premiered on October 23, 2009. In December 2009, White Collar was renewed for just a second season that started on July 13, 2010. On September 27, 2010, the USA Network renewed White Collar for the third season with of sixteen new episodes, which premiered on 06 7, 2011. The series was renewed for just a fourth season on May 25, 2011.
Neal Caffrey, a con man, forger and thief, is captured after the three-year game of cat and mouse while using the FBI. With only months eventually left while serving a four-year sentence, [3] he escapes from the maximum security federal prison to discover Kate, his ex-girlfriend. Peter Burke, the FBI agent who initially captured Caffrey, finds him and profits Caffrey to prison. This time, Caffrey gives Burke information regarding evidence in another case; however, this information comes using a price: Burke must have a meeting with Caffrey. At this meeting, Caffrey proposes a deal: he will help Burke catch other criminals in a work-release program. Burke agrees, after some hesitation. Through the successful apprehending connected with several white collar bad guys, Caffrey has proven to Burke that she will help him, and that he won’t try to escape all over again. This begins an unconventional but successful partnership.
